文章分类 - CSS
摘要:什么使用嵌套的层? 最近一个好奇的读者问起了关于 Adaptive Path 的网站重构:“对于主导航栏的设计,我一直很困惑,为什么把一个具有绝对位置(absolute)的层嵌套在一个具有相对位置(relative)的层中?” 一个简单的答案是:因为我想要使标题和导航栏具有最适宜的灵活性,并且无论文本大小如何变化,都能保持导航栏与LOGO之间的距离不变。 这是战略性(strategic)的答案,它...
        阅读全文
                
摘要:在CSS中的“滑动门”技术(第一部分)中,我们介绍了一种技术,通过它,仅用简单的,基于文字的语义标记就可以创建出视觉效果极好的界面元素。在第二部分中,我们将把这项技术向前推进一步。如果你还没有读过第一部分,那么首先应该去阅读它。 现在,我们来看一种新的设定:所有的标签都是非高亮的,仅用一幅图片实现滑动门的滚动,为IE/Win提供可点击区域问题的解决办法,并且建议使用一种不同的方式来定位标签。为了回...
        阅读全文
                
摘要:在CSS中,一个很少被提及的优点就是能够层叠背景图片,允许它们之间通过"滑动"和层叠来创造出特定的效果。CSS2目前的状况要求每个背景图片都分别有与之相对应的HTML元素。在通常情况下,组成通用界面的典型标记已经提供了一些我们可以使用的元素。 其中的一个例子就是标签导航栏(tabbed navigation)。随着[标签导航]的使用率不断上升,它已逐渐成为了站点导航的主流方式,现在是时候来讨论一下...
        阅读全文
                
摘要:早在99年7月,我就在邮件列表中鼓吹样式表(style sheets)的种种优越之处。看来有些事情永远都不会改变。 而改变了的,是我对CSS的看法,以及它所应用于(X)HTML的底层结构。例如,我发现大多数的网页在导航区都包含一个链接的菜单。它们通常被编辑成一串链接,常常各自以层(div)或段落的方式来标记(markup)。然而,从结构上讲,它们是一个链接列表,并且也应该用列表来标记。 当然,之所...
        阅读全文
                
摘要:网络标准计划( WaSP )中的浏览器升级行动( BUI )已经促使许多设计人员朝着更加标准化的网页设计方向前进。使用CSS而不是表格来为网页布局能够节省用户带宽,同时增强页面的底层语义,可访问性及其范围。 “表格已死...” 已经有几位设计师在Jeffrey Zeldman的 引领 下发表了一些指南,这些指南曾经帮助我们度过无表格设计的困难时期。最初的努力主要是集中在通过CSS定位(CSS po...
        阅读全文
                
 
                    
                     
                    
                 
                    
                
 
         浙公网安备 33010602011771号
浙公网安备 33010602011771号